Answer: B. BOLLGARD I AND BOLLGARD II technologies are GENETICALLY MODIFIED CROP PLANT TECHNOLOGIES.
BOLLGARD is a trade name for GENETICALLY MODIFIED COTTON varieties developed by MONSANTO (now part of Bayer), in which BACILLUS THURINGIENSIS (Bt) GENES encoding insecticidal Cry proteins have been introduced into the cotton genome. The Bt proteins are toxic to BOLLWORMS — specifically the COTTON BOLLWORM (Helicoverpa armigera) and PINK BOLLWORM (Pectinophora gossypiella) — but harmless to mammals.
- BOLLGARD I: Contains the CRY1AC gene from B. thuringiensis. Approved in India in 2002. Provides protection against bollworms.
- BOLLGARD II: Contains TWO Bt genes — CRY1AC and CRY2AB — providing broader pest spectrum control and reducing the risk of pest resistance evolution. Approved in India in 2006.
Bt cotton was India's FIRST and (initially) ONLY commercially approved GM crop. Roughly 95% of India's cotton acreage shifted to Bt varieties within a decade, dramatically reducing pesticide use against bollworms. However, pink bollworm has subsequently evolved resistance to Bollgard II, prompting calls for next-generation (Bollgard III, RNAi-based) technologies, and exposing GM-stewardship gaps.
